Program areas at Society for Integrative Oncology
Sio has continued to lead the field of Integrative Oncology by hosting an international research workshop in limassol, cyprus; developing educational training modules funded by the scheidel foundation on the 2022 joint sio- asco guideline publication on management of cancer pain; and publishing a new joint guideline on the care of anxiety and depressive symptoms in cancer, which is being promoted internationally. A second grant from the scheidel foundation (45,000) was received to develop training modules with cme for this guideline. Sio also formed a reciprocal conference session partnership with mascc (multi-national association of supportive care in cancer), and continues to partner with key organizations and journals. The Society celebrated its 20th anniversary and international conference in banff, alberta with a record number of scientific abstract submissions, an e-book publication on the history of sio, and a successful donation drive (over 85,000).
